Ticket: BLM-412 — Expired credentials on Siftgate bloom filter

The Siftgate bloom filter fronting the Cobbleton KV store started rejecting membership checks at 03:10; its read credential expired after the 90-day policy kicked in. Traffic fell through to the KV store directly, tripling read latency. Rotation was performed via the Keyforge console and verified against staging. Requesting security sign-off on the new credential scope (read-only, filter namespace). For verification, the rotated key is below.

gateway credential: kto23_LX9A4ys6i4nzHtpOLNLodKK

Finance Review — Launch Plan, Vexa Trail Series. Launch budget for the Vexa Trail line is confirmed at plan, with marketing spend front-loaded into the first quarter. Margin targets are achievable if the Corrandale channel hits forecast. Sales leads should review territory quotas this week. Please keep the following note within this group.

board note of tawig-bajof: The renewal with Ralixix Holdings closes at $10 million a year, 20 percent above the last contract. Project Druix slips by two quarters because of the tooling delay.

Minutes — Management Meeting, Veldrane Instruments

Attendees: R. Moss, T. Calloway, sales leads.

Decision: the Orbix 300 gauge line retires end of Q3. No new orders after August. Spares support runs 18 months. Existing pipeline deals close on current terms; no discounting beyond standard. Migration path is the Orbix 500 series. Calloway to circulate transition scripts by Friday. Questions route through regional managers only. The strategic rationale is summarized in the confidential note below.

confidential, fafog-fafog: Only 21 of the 82 pilot accounts renewed Holwyn, so a churn review is set for September 1. Normirox Logistics is in early talks to buy Praiusox Foods for about $134.2 million.